How is Heidelberger Druckmaschinen shifting from presses to productivity?

Heidelberger Druckmaschinen has moved from selling hardware to selling workflow, uptime and sustainability outcomes, led by innovations like the Speedmaster XL 106 with Push to Stop that boosted net output by 20–30%.

What is Sales and Marketing Strategy of Heidelberger Druckmaschinen Company?

Sales now emphasize bundled subscriptions—presses, Prinect workflow, Saphira consumables and predictive service—sold via dealers, direct enterprise teams and trade-show momentum to stabilize utilization and monetise uptime. How Does Heidelberger Druckmaschinen Reach Its Customers?

Heidelberger Druckmaschinen sales channels combine direct enterprise selling, regional dealers and a growing digital layer to serve commercial, packaging and label printers, with emphasis on subscriptions, eShop transactions and key-account frameworks.

Icon Direct Enterprise Sales

Dedicated direct teams target high-complexity commercial, packaging and label converters, handling presales, commissioning and global account management for multi-site customers.

Icon Authorized Dealers & Integrators

Local dealers provide on-site support and installation in Asia, LATAM and parts of EMEA, extending reach for SMB commercial printers where localized service is decisive.

Icon Lifecycle & Subscription Models

Heidelberg Subscription and pay-per-outcome offerings bundle hardware, Prinect software, service and Saphira consumables to smooth cyclicality and deepen wallet share.

Icon eShop & Digital Portals

Parts, consumables and service renewals are sold via Heidelberg eShop and service portals; in mature markets >60% of service/consumables orders now originate or renew digitally.

Channel evolution from 2018–2025 emphasized subscriptions, IoT-enabled SLAs, remote diagnostics and a stronger push into packaging and labels, with mix shifts toward DTC for complex presses and distributors for SMBs.

Icon

Channel Performance & Partnerships

Over 80% of equipment revenue historically flows through direct and major-dealer motions; packaging-related order intake outpaced legacy commercial print in 2023–2025 industry reports.

  • Heidelberg Subscription increases recurring revenue and customer retention.
  • IoT uptime SLAs and remote commissioning reduced service visits and improved OEE.
  • RIP/workflow interoperability with Adobe PDF Print Engine and MIS/ERP integrations enhance workflow sales.
  • Exclusive framework agreements with multi-site packaging groups expanded folding carton share.

What Marketing Tactics Does Heidelberger Druckmaschinen Use?

Heidelberg’s marketing tactics blend ABM-driven enterprise outreach, always-on digital demand generation, and event-led product theatre to drive equipment sales, consumables, and service subscriptions across global markets.

Icon

Digital-first demand engine

SEO and thought leadership target OEE, makeready reduction and energy efficiency to capture operations leaders and CFOs searching for efficiency gains.

Icon

ABM and paid targeting

LinkedIn ABM and paid search focus on enterprise prospects; campaigns use lead scoring in CRM/MA stacks to prioritize high-value accounts.

Icon

Telemetry-driven nurturing

Email nurture ties to connected-press telemetry (maintenance windows, click-charge usage) to upsell consumables and service contracts.

Icon

Event-led product theatre

Major shows (drupa, Labelexpo, PRINTING United) and regional open houses deliver hands-on demos; events are amplified by digital sprints and customer-reference syndication.

Icon

Content and social proof

Webinars, virtual demos of Prinect and Push to Stop, and ROI case videos build credibility; trade press placements in Packaging World and FESPA support category authority.

Icon

Data-driven personalization

IoT data segments customers by run-lengths, substrate mix and uptime; personalized TCO calculators and subscription pricing tools quantify value in pre-sales.

Icon

Operational tactics and analytics

Analytics enable multi-touch attribution across events, digital, and dealer pipelines; sales enablement is localized for more than 50 markets and the mix has shifted to always-on pipeline generation with event spikes amplified digitally.

  • Telemetry-fed segmentation powers targeted ABM outreach and lifecycle marketing.
  • AI-assisted service recommendations surface uptime benefits during pre-sales to increase attach rates.
  • Subscription and click-charge models supported by virtual factory tours and online pricing calculators.
  • Multi-touch attribution measures campaign ROI; dealers receive localized sales kits tied to measurable KPIs.

How Is Heidelberger Druckmaschinen Positioned in the Market?

Brand positioning centers on end-to-end productivity and sustainable print performance, differentiating through integrated workflows, autonomous changeovers, predictive service and lifecycle economics to deliver measurable OEE and lower energy per sheet.

Icon Value Proposition

Positioned as a premium, low-risk partner emphasizing measurable OEE gains, faster makeready and subscription SLAs that guarantee uptime for commercial and packaging converters.

Icon Product Differentiation

Core differentiators are integrated Prinect workflow, Push to Stop autonomous changeovers and predictive service—contrasting with single-point machine sellers focused on sticker price.

Icon Visual & Tone

Engineering-forward visual identity: clean industrial design, blue/gray palette and data dashboards; tone emphasizes ROI, reliability and sustainability compliance across channels.

Icon Sustainability Focus

Marketing highlights reduced waste sheets, recyclability and energy-optimized press components; packaging offers target FMCG-aligned converters addressing Scope 3 goals.

Icon

Performance Proof-points

Unified proof-points used across website, eShop, events and dealer collateral: throughput, changeover minutes and kWh/sheet metrics demonstrated in benchmarks.

Icon

Target Audience

Appeals to decision-makers seeking premium capex with predictable TCO and scalable packaging growth rather than bargain pricing; customer segmentation focuses on converters, commercial printers and brand-aligned partners.

Icon

Economic Cycle Messaging

Messaging shifts by cycle: in downcycles emphasise resilience and lower TCO via Service & SLA models; in upcycles highlight growth capacity and faster time-to-market for short runs.

Icon

Go-to-Market & Channels

Channel mix blends direct sales, subscription SLAs and an extensive dealer network; digital lead generation and CRM-driven sales enablement support conversion and aftermarket growth.

Icon

Service & Subscription

Service offerings and subscription SLAs guarantee uptime; predictive maintenance reduces unplanned stoppages—benchmarks and awards in 2023–2024 consistently cite automation and workflow integration.

Icon

Market Perception

Industry places the company among leaders in sheetfed offset and as a credible, ascendant player in high-speed packaging and services, supported by third-party benchmarks and awards for automation.

Icon

Key Metrics & Evidence

Marketing emphasizes concrete metrics and case studies to support product positioning and sales strategy.

  • Published case studies report double-digit OEE improvements and makeready reductions under 10 minutes for select presses.
  • Energy efficiency claims use kWh/sheet benchmarks to quantify lower energy per sheet versus legacy models.
  • Subscription SLAs advertise guaranteed uptime with defined remedies and service-level credits.
  • Packaging press messaging targets converters aiming to lower Scope 3 emissions for FMCG clients.

What Are Heidelberger Druckmaschinen’s Most Notable Campaigns?

Key Campaigns of Heidelberger Druckmaschinen focus on measurable productivity, subscription economics, packaging acceleration and an integrated workflow narrative to drive sales pipeline, contract adoption and market share in 2023–2025.

Icon Push to Stop Productivity Series (ongoing)

Customer video case studies quantify autonomy-driven output gains of 15–30% net throughput and makeready reductions to single-digit minutes, promoted via YouTube, LinkedIn, trade advertorials, drupa theatre and regional open houses.

Icon Key results & lessons

Above-benchmark LinkedIn CTRs for industrial audiences, faster pipeline velocity and wider subscription attach rates; success factor: hard ROI proof and operator testimonials, lesson: local-language proof beats generic global creative.

Icon Heidelberg Subscription ROI Calculator Launch (2022–2024)

Interactive TCO and uptime model using IoT benchmarks targeted at driving lifecycle contract adoption through site tools, ABM email sequences, SDR demos and webinars.

Icon Key results & lessons

Delivered double-digit lift in qualified packaging converter opportunities and higher win rates versus capex-only offers; success factor: finance-oriented storytelling, lesson: transparent KPI ranges reduce procurement friction.

Icon Boardmaster Packaging Acceleration (2023–2025)

High-speed flexo entry via apples-to-apples performance showcases against incumbent lines, focusing on waste reduction and changeover speed with co-hosted runs at converter sites and demonstrations at Labelexpo/FachPack.

Icon Key results & lessons

Achieved pipeline penetration in multi-site converters, early multi-press framework agreements and share gains in select EMEA accounts; success factor: on-site trials, lesson: operations-led proof converts faster than spec sheets.

Icon drupa 2024 Integrated Workflow Showcase

End-to-end live jobs highlighted Prinect, AI assistance and energy metrics across prepress to postpress with on-stand demos, livestreams and press briefings.

Icon Key results & lessons

Surge in demo requests, expanded consumables cross-sell and elevated media share-of-voice during the show; success factor: system-level narrative, lesson: automated follow-up cadences capture post-event intent.
